STUDENT EXPERIENCE ADMINISTRATOR (ASSESSMENT) - MATERNITY COVER
Grade 5

£29,588 - £33,951 pa

Working within the Student Experience Team in the Institute of Population Health, you will play an important role in supporting students and academic staff on our Undergraduate Programmes, in relation to Assessments.

You should have excellent customer service and interpersonal skills, with the ability to work effectively under pressure in a challenging environment.

You should have 3 GCSE’s at Grade C or above (or equivalent) including English Language, with high level IT, communication and organisational skills. Experience of Microsoft Office is essential and experience of University IT systems (BANNER, Canvas, TULIP and ORBIT) is desirable.

This post is offered on a fixed term basis to cover a period of maternity leave, expected to be from March 2026 until February 2027. For existing University of Liverpool staff, this post may be offered as a secondment opportunity with the agreement of your current line manager.
